Expect road closures near Boca Raton rally

- By Marci Shatzman Staff writer

A March for Our Lives rally will take place today in Boca Raton, drawing a crowd and road closures.

The Boca rally, which is expected to draw at least 2,500 people, is among the hundreds of demonstrat­ions planned across the country. Their aim: to boost school safety and push for tougher gun-control legislatio­n.

Participan­ts can register from 10 to 10:30 a.m. at the baseball fields behind Boca Raton City Hall at Crawford Boulevard and Palmetto Park Road. The first 1,000 people to show will get a T-shirt and water bottle.

There will be a march that starts at 10:30 a.m. from City Hall. It’ll head to Mizner Park Amphitheat­er at 590 Plaza Real, where there will be speakers and performanc­es starting at noon. It’s expected to last until 2 p.m.

Roads near Boca Raton City Hall at 201 W. Palmetto Park Road will be closed from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. along the march route.

The route will go north on Crawford Boulevard, turn right on Northwest Fourth Diagonal and run south on Northwest Boca Raton Boulevard. Then it will head east on Northwest Second Street and turn north on Plaza Real toward the amphitheat­er off Federal Highway, just north of Palmetto Park Road.

The southbound lanes in Mizner Park will be closed to traffic. Drivers are asked to use Mizner Boulevard or Northwest Fourth Avenue as detours.

Guest speakers will include high schoolers, and Boca Raton Mayor Susan Haynie. Food trucks will be available.

Those going to the rally are urged to carpool.

There will be free parking available at: Boca Raton City Hall; Boca Raton Community Center, 150 Crawford Blvd.;

the Downtown Library, 400 NW Second Ave.;

the Boca Raton Building Administra­tion, 200 NW Second Ave.;

Mizner Park Amphitheat­er has four free parking garages, metered street parking and paid valet services at the restaurant­s.
